[ARM] latencytop support
authorNicolas Pitre <nico@cam.org>
Thu, 24 Apr 2008 05:31:46 +0000 (01:31 -0400)
committerLennert Buytenhek <buytenh@marvell.com>
Sun, 22 Jun 2008 20:44:36 +0000 (22:44 +0200)
Available for !SMP only at the moment.

From Russell:

|Basically, if a thread is running on a CPU, thread_saved_fp() is invalid.
|So, the question is: what guarantees do we have here that 'tsk' is not
|running on another CPU?
